Transaction 5f8ad932d406cedbc37a1108ab2341932dc72389fde1ddcc553f284cf5768db7
3 Input
2 Outputs
- 5f8ad932d406cedbc37a1108ab2341932dc72389fde1ddcc553f284cf5768db7:0
- 5f8ad932d406cedbc37a1108ab2341932dc72389fde1ddcc553f284cf5768db7:1
value 108389
address 1E28SLpk931Pqa9G6p1jAuNULcWz5qZ8ti
value 3576283
address 1EbxsL1wCrfhfW9EAgdYxMZxXhaZmsR86y